Typing Urdu in MS Word or in any Software

Whenever we think to type Urdu only one name came in mind i.e. Inpage. It is good software but it isn’t as vast as compared to MS Word or any other word processor of English. I always thought that I could type Urdu in Microsoft Word. That problem is been solved when Microsoft introduced plenty of Asian languages including Urdu. By installing Urdu we could change complete windows language, now we could type Urdu, but it is still very difficult to type, because the Monotype Keyboard layout is not that easy. It is very difficult to remember each key for every character.
Now we not only can set Urdu language as our default language but also can type Urdu in every software easily. Inpage has a phonetic keyboard layout, it is very easy to remember because like its name almost every key in the keyboard represents the character of Urdu that sounds the same. Now we could install that keyboard layout to type easily.

Here is a step by step process

  1. Open Control Panel
  2. Open Regional and Language Options
  3. Click on languages tab & select the option "Install files for East Asian languages" Install the necessary files from the Windows XP CD
  4. Now to change the computer language go to Regional Options tab and change the Language to Urdu
  5. To start typing Urdu in any software go to Advanced tab and change the language to Urdu
  6. Download Phonetic Keyboard Layout http://www.crulp.org/software/localization/keyboards/CRULPphonetickbv1.1.html
  7. Install the software and go to the Languages tab in Regional Settings and click on details button. Select the CRULP phonetic keyboard and you are done.
Now we can type Urdu in any software of Windows

Converting Word or any Printable document into a Mirror document

What is the Mirrored text/image?

If we see something in a mirror it looks like that it has been reversed or flipped. Same thing happened here that when we convert the text it will be flipped over

Mirrored text or images are widely used by designers for various Web or printing purposes. We can easily convert by using drawing tools but we cannot find method to convert complete Word or other text documents or from other Office applications.


The easy and effective way to mirror almost every document without losing quality is: to do it with a very commonly used software i.e. “Adobe Acrobat Professional”. You could download it from Adobe website


To convert documents into mirror Just follow the steps and you are done:


Step 1:

Install “Adobe Acrobat Professional” any version (I’m using Adobe Acrobat Professional 8.1). If you already have, skip this.


Step 2:

Open the document that you would like to mirror.


Step 3:

Open the print dialog (“Ctrl + P” used for printing almost in every software)


Step 4:

From your printers list choose “Adobe PDF”


Step 5:

Click “Properties” button and from “Layout” Tab press “advanced” button.


Step 6:

From the dialog box expand the “PostScript Options” select “Yes” from “Mirrored output” option & press “Ok”.



Step 7:

Press “print” button a save dialog box will open enter the name and it’s done.

Open the saved Pdf file and it will be mirrored.

Typing a Table in MS Word

Here is a short and simple way of typing a table, instead of the old fashioned draw / insert table command usually taken from the menu. Now for the purpose of creating table you can type a string of “+” and “-” signs. The string starts and ends with the “+” sign and in between we place a series of “-“signs that are required to represent the width of the column and press enter key and it’s done. This creates your one column for the next column or columns after "+" sign continuing with "-" sign upto width of the next column and so on until you finished the desired number of columns.

Example:

Suppose we need a table which has three columns.




So we type:

“+-------------------------+-------------------------+-------------------------+”

Note: The string must be typed without double quote marks.
